The Upcoming Sony Ericsson P700i Smartphone

Here is the first look at the Sony Ericsson’s forthcoming P700i smartphone. The phone will come with a 2.6-inch QVGA screen, 3.2MP camera with duplex LED light, and sports 3G, Wi-Fi, and Bluetooth. The phone will also have a two-letter-per-key keyboard. Pricing and availability are still in a mystery.

Ubuntu Linux Running On Sony Ericsson P990i Phone

Someone at YouTube shows us the Sony Ericsson P990i phone which uses a copy of Ubuntu Linux as its operating system. FYI, the smartphone features a 240 x 320 TFT touchscreen display, 2.0MP shooter, 64MB RAM, 128MB Flash memory, 60MB built-in memory, 802.11b Wi-Fi, Bluetooth 2.0, a music player, and USB 2.0 connectivity.

Samsung SCH-i760 Receives FCC Approval

The Almighty FCC has approved the Samsung SCH-i760 smartphone that comes equipped with Windows Mobile 6 operating system. The gadget supports for applications such as Word, Excel and PowerPoint. The smartphone also provides a QWERTY keyboard that shared the same thick black like the rest of the phones body. Other features include 1.3MP shooter, and a camcorder. What’s more, the Samsung SCH-i760 also features a MP3 player and sports Wi-Fi connectivity. No info on pricing or availability yet.

FCC Approved Samsung SCH-i760 Smartphone

Some dudes at the FCC has approved the Samsung SCH-i760 CDMA smartphone. As a result, the device will be available very soon. As a reminder, the SCH-i760 runs on Windows Mobile 6.0 and boasts a 1.3MP camera with video recording capability, an integrated MP3 player, landscape and portrait display options, WiFi connectivity, and a simple horizontal sliding function that reveals a full QWERTY keyboard. Sadly, there is no info on pricing yet.

The Upcoming HTC P4550 Smartphone

The HTC P4550 smartphone measures 58mm x 110mm x 18mm and weighs 160grams (battery included). The gadget is powered by Windows Mobile 6 Professional, a 32bit Samsung SC32442 CPU, and 64 MB RAM. The smartphone is also equipped with a 2.8 inch TFT Screen and sports CSD, GPRS, EDGE, UMTS, HSDPA, HSUPA. Other specs includes SDIO, microSD, TransFlash slot, USB 2.0 client, Bluetooth 2.0, WLAN, 2.8MP digicam and 640×480 VGA Camera. The HTC P4550 smartphone will be available soon.
